Swimmers Up Record to 4-1
Patchogue, NY- The University of Bridgeport women’s swimming and diving team swept St. Joseph’s College and SUNY Old Westbury 150-80 on Saturday afternoon in a double dual meet hosted St. Joseph’s College in Patchogue, NY. UB nipped St. Joe’s by two points, 112-10, and they defeated SUNY Old Westbury, 150-68. […]
Men’s Basketball Defeats Dowling In ECC Opener, 77-65
Bridgeport, CT-Junior transfer Quentin Martin (White Plains, NY/St. Peter’s College) notched a double-double with 18 points and 12 rebounds to help the University of Bridgeport Purple Knights to a 77-65 home win over the Dowling College Golden Lions in the East Coast Conference opener for both teams on Wednesday night. Sodexho’s Traveling Chef Makes a Stop at UB
Students and staff got a special treat on Thursday, November 15 when Alfonso Soto, Sodexho’s traveling chef arrived at Marina Hall at 7am to prepare a special Japanese culinary exhibition for their enjoyment during International Week.
